## Deployment

The Pedalwise rebalancer computes hourly dock-transfer plans for the Gallenport bike-share network and pushes them to dispatcher tablets. Deploy it as a single scheduled job, never as a long-running service — overlapping runs produce conflicting transfer plans. New team members should deploy to the sandbox region first and compare the generated plan against the previous day's before promoting. Rollbacks are just a redeploy of the prior image; the planner is stateless. On each run the job loads the following configuration values.

config for tawif-bagef:
[sorwyn]
team = sorys
access_code = ac_9ba40c
host = sorwyn.ordingrid.local
port = 5000
owner = aldok.quenion
peer = belath.paliqcloud.local

Ticket GARAGE-412: Stale occupancy counts on Lot Feed

The Parkwise occupancy feed for the Hollis Street garage reports 100% full even when bays are open. To reproduce: open the Lot Feed dashboard, select Hollis Street, refresh twice within 30 seconds. Counts freeze at the second refresh. Verified on staging and prod. Use the token below when querying the feed endpoint directly.

session JWT of yawep-yawep = eyJhbGciOiJIUzI1NiIsInR5cCI6IkpXVCJ9.eyJzdWIiOiI3pWF3_In0.aXYsHiog

Action item: The Relayn deploy-status bot silently dropped updates when the pipeline API paginated results, so responders believed a rollback had completed when it had not. We will add pagination handling, a staleness banner, and an integration test. Until merged, verify deploy state directly in the pipeline console, documented at the page below.

runbook for kahop-kajop: https://rundeck.ordinio.test/display/secrets/pipeline/issue/pages/repo/browse/e5732776e07d1285107e5aeb

TICKET OPS-4417 — Vault locked after breaker trip

Circuit breaker for the Pellwright upstream API tripped during the retry storm and the config vault auto-locked. Review the half-open threshold change in the attached diff before merge. Breaker state resets on redeploy; vault does not. To reopen the vault for the reviewer sandbox, enter the recovery passphrase below.

recovery phrase for tagug-yagug: lamox-gilax-keleth-gilath